The four primary deployment models in multi-site healthcare ERP
Most multi-site healthcare ERP programs align to one of four enterprise deployment platform models: centralized core deployment, regional hub deployment, phased site-by-site rollout, or hybrid federated deployment. Each model has implications for implementation modernization, governance overhead, workflow automation, onboarding effort, and managed services design. Partners that can evaluate these tradeoffs credibly are better positioned to move beyond software resale and into higher-margin implementation lifecycle management.
| Deployment Model | Best Fit | Primary Advantage | Primary Risk | Partner Revenue Opportunity |
|---|---|---|---|---|
| Centralized core deployment | Highly standardized health systems with strong central governance | Maximum workflow standardization and reporting consistency | Local resistance and slower adoption if site variation is ignored | Program governance, data migration, onboarding, managed optimization |
| Regional hub deployment | Large networks with semi-autonomous operating regions | Balances standardization with regional flexibility | Governance complexity across hubs | Regional PMO support, integration management, analytics services |
| Phased site-by-site rollout | Organizations with uneven readiness across facilities | Lower disruption and better change absorption | Longer transformation timeline and temporary process fragmentation | Recurring rollout services, training, adoption support, managed cutover |
| Hybrid federated deployment | Networks with shared finance or HR but localized clinical administration | Preserves local operating realities while standardizing core controls | Architecture and policy complexity | Solution architecture, workflow design, observability, managed governance |
How partners should evaluate model selection
Model selection should be based on administrative process maturity, data quality, leadership alignment, integration dependencies, and the customer's tolerance for operational disruption. In healthcare, finance and procurement may be ready for centralization while workforce administration, scheduling, or local supply workflows remain site-specific. A credible implementation partner ecosystem approach therefore starts with operating model diagnostics rather than software configuration alone. Governance and change management are the deciding factors in deployment success
Healthcare ERP failures are rarely caused by software capability alone. They typically result from weak implementation governance, fragmented decision rights, inconsistent site readiness, poor data ownership, and inadequate change management. Multi-site administrative transformation requires a formal governance structure that defines enterprise standards, local exception handling, escalation paths, release controls, and adoption accountability. Partners that embed governance into their implementation platform are more likely to deliver resilient outcomes and create follow-on managed implementation services.
| Governance Domain | What Must Be Defined | Why It Matters | Managed Service Extension |
|---|---|---|---|
| Decision rights | Who approves global standards versus local exceptions | Prevents rollout delays and policy conflicts | Ongoing governance office support |
| Data ownership | Master data stewardship, quality controls, and update cadence | Improves reporting integrity and migration reliability | Managed data quality monitoring |
| Release management | Testing, validation, and deployment windows | Reduces operational disruption across sites | Managed release coordination |
| Adoption accountability | Training completion, usage metrics, and remediation actions | Improves user adoption and process compliance | Customer success and adoption analytics |
| Operational observability | Issue tracking, workflow bottlenecks, and service health dashboards | Supports resilience and continuous improvement | Implementation observability services |
Change management should be treated as an operational workstream, not a communications afterthought. Administrative users across finance, HR, procurement, and shared services need role-specific process education, not generic ERP training. Site leaders need visibility into what is changing, when local exceptions will be retired, and how performance will be measured. Onboarding and adoption strategies for multi-site healthcare environments
Onboarding in healthcare ERP should be sequenced by role criticality, process dependency, and site readiness. Finance super users, procurement approvers, HR administrators, and shared services teams typically require early enablement because they influence downstream adoption. Site-level users need contextual training tied to actual workflows, approval paths, and exception scenarios. A cloud-native deployment platform can support this through digital onboarding journeys, workflow simulations, role-based access provisioning, and operational analytics that identify where adoption is lagging.
Partners should recommend a three-layer adoption model. First, establish enterprise process baselines and role definitions. Second, deliver site-specific onboarding with localized examples and cutover support. Third, monitor post-go-live usage, ticket patterns, and workflow exceptions to trigger targeted remediation. This approach reduces failed implementations caused by low user confidence and creates a natural managed implementation services motion. Instead of ending at training completion, the partner remains engaged through measurable adoption outcomes.
